Hiking around Villers-Stoncourt offers diverse landscapes within the Rhin-Meuse basin, characterized by its network of streams like the Elvon, Hemilly, and Malroy. The terrain features a varied elevation ranging from 224 to 328 meters, providing gentle ascents and descents. Hikers can explore the dense Forest of Remilly and open agricultural fields situated between the French and German Nied rivers. This blend of woodlands and open spaces defines the region's natural environment.

This typical castle of classicism was built in the 18th century. Property of the Pange family, it is entrusted to an association responsible for making it a house of arts, encounters and cultures. Besides the building, the gardens are also splendid. More information is available on the chateau website: http://www.chateaudepange.fr/.

The castle dates from 1720 and was the residence of the Marquis de Pange. It is still family-owned today and unfortunately (currently) not open to the public.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Villers-Stoncourt?

There are over 80 hiking trails around Villers-Stoncourt, catering to various fitness levels. You'll find a mix of easy strolls, moderate treks, and a few more challenging routes.

Are there any easy hiking trails suitable for beginners or families in Villers-Stoncourt?

Yes, Villers-Stoncourt offers over 35 easy hiking trails. An excellent option is the Notre-Dame du Chêne Chapel loop from Villers-Stoncourt, an easy 7.5 km path that takes just under 2 hours to complete, perfect for a relaxed outing.

What kind of landscapes can I expect to see while hiking in Villers-Stoncourt?

Hiking in Villers-Stoncourt offers a diverse range of landscapes. You'll traverse verdant stream valleys, dense woodlands like the Forest of Remilly, and open agricultural fields situated between the French and German Nied rivers. The terrain features gentle ascents and descents, providing varied scenery.

Are there any circular hiking routes in the Villers-Stoncourt area?

Yes, many of the trails around Villers-Stoncourt are circular. For example, the Saint-Maximin Church loop from Pange is a moderate 8.8 km circular route that takes you through rural landscapes and past the historic church.

What historical landmarks or points of interest can I explore on a hike?

Several trails incorporate historical landmarks. You can explore the surroundings of the historic Pange Castle on routes like the Pange Castle loop from Courcelles-Chaussy. Another notable point is the Mont Saint-Pierre, which offers scenic views and is part of the Mont Saint-Pierre – Mante Heights loop from Villers-Stoncourt.

What do other hikers enjoy most about the trails in Villers-Stoncourt?

The trails in Villers-Stoncourt are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 90 reviews. Hikers often praise the varied terrain, the peaceful woodlands, and the charming rural landscapes that make for an enjoyable outdoor experience.

Are there any trails that offer good viewpoints or scenic vistas?

Yes, the region's varied elevation provides opportunities for scenic views. The Mont Saint-Pierre – Mante Heights loop from Villers-Stoncourt, for instance, spans over 11 kilometers and offers more significant elevation changes, leading to expansive views, particularly from Mont Saint-Pierre.

What is the typical duration for hikes around Villers-Stoncourt?

Hikes around Villers-Stoncourt vary in duration. Many popular routes, such as the Pange Castle loop from Pange, can be completed in about 2 to 2.5 hours. Longer options, like the Mont Saint-Pierre – Mante Heights loop, can take over 3 hours.

Is the area suitable for hiking in different seasons?

The diverse landscapes of Villers-Stoncourt, with its forests and open fields, offer different experiences throughout the year. While specific seasonal advice isn't available, the region's climate, characterized as a mountainous margin type, suggests varied conditions. Always check local weather before heading out.

Are there any specific natural features to look out for on the trails?

The region is characterized by its network of streams, including the Elvon, Hemilly, and Malroy, which contribute to its verdant character. You'll also encounter the dense Forest of Remilly, which borders the hamlet of Aoury, offering a rich woodland experience.
